Ticket: Health-check vault sealed — Lorrigan load balancer

For new team members: the Lorrigan balancer's health-check probes authenticate against a small credentials vault, which sealed during yesterday's certificate swap. Until unsealed, probes mark backends unhealthy and traffic drains incorrectly. Unseal it per runbook section 2; the required recovery passphrase is appended directly below.

strongbox words: druwyn-lamvan-julath-sorox-ralius-wenael-briiel-aldiel-ulaius-belath-casath-ulamir-ulair-norir

Hey Talia, handing over the Carstack occupancy feed. The Ellermont garage sensors dropped out twice overnight; the feed recovered on its own but counts drifted about 40 stalls high until the 03:00 reconciliation ran. I've left the replay job paused so you can inspect the gap first. Watch the drift gauge after lunch. If the vendor gateway flakes again, ping their liaison at the address below.

pager mailbox: zoreth@zemvarsoft.test

**Audit item 14 — Monthly partitioning on Ledgerfox tables.** Hey, welcome aboard! Quick one: verify every large table in the Ledgerfox warehouse is partitioned by calendar month, not by insert date. We've been burned before when someone partitioned by week and the retention job silently skipped rows. Check the partition naming follows the `_yyyymm` suffix pattern, confirm the oldest partition matches the 18-month retention rule, and note anything weird in the audit log. If something looks off, don't fix it yourself — flag the owner first.

account owner for bawip-tahag: Raleth Quenok

## Step 4: Configure the Retention Sweeper

The Dunmere sweeper deletes records past their retention window, so configure it carefully before first run. Set `SWEEPER_DRY_RUN=true` for the initial pass and review the audit log. The sweeper authenticates to the archive store with a credential, which you should place on the following line of the env file.

vault entry, bagep-yahip: VAULT_KEY8=d2a227e5